UNC football on the rise in latest 247Sports top 25 rankings


Over the past week, the Big 10 and Pac-12 are among those to join the MAC in postposing all fall sports until a later date, and because of that, college football programs from the ACC, Big 12, SEC and other conferences are on the rise in 247Sports’ latest top 25 for 2020. North Carolina is among those that have seen the biggest jump in the site’s latest rankings. (Keeping It Heel)
